Otter Creek, FL

Jan 2019


Address: 190 US-19, Otter Creek, FL, Levy, USA, 32683


To get to Cedar Key you have to take US98 to state road 24 and drive for a good little ways. Otter creek is the 120 person tiny town on that corner - I didn't realize it was at the level of town at first. It has some charm and is worth stopping for a snack or turning into the actual little town part south of that intersection.

